We have version 5.0 USG Unix and have a number of problems with uucp: 1. LCK.XQT being left around with no uuxqt running. 2. filename expansion (either version of '~') not being handled properly on at least the receiving side. In one particular instance, a file sent to sys!~usr ended up in /usr/spool/uucp/uucppublic/usr/file (NOT even in /usr/spool/uucppublic which would also be incorrect!) Actually, I think the user sent the file to his rje directory. In another instance, a file sent to users rje directory using '~usr/rje' ended up in uucppublic but somehow all the permissions were 600, owned by uucp!!! 3. uucico enters into an infinite alarm condition: alarm 1, alarm 2, ... alarm n,... Is anybody else using 5.0? Have you had any problems? If you are using 5.0, the 'fclose' is still missing in uuxqt.c, among other known bugs that USG has not fixed.
